#1f03e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f03e3 is composed of 12.2% red, 1.2%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 247.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 45.1%. #1f03e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e06ff with #0000c7.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#1f03e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f03e3 has RGB values of R:31, G:3,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2032611.

Shades and Tints of #1f03e3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000e is the darkest color, while #fafa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f03e3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6d79 is the less saturated color, while #1f03e3 is the most saturated one.
